
Juliette Sigurnjak brings steady guard minutes and veteran polish to Ave Maria
In the 2025-26 season, Juliette Sigurnjak has been a rotation guard for Ave Maria, appearing in multiple games and giving the Gyrenes a 5-foot-8 backcourt option with experience and composure.[1][10] Her 2024-25 season line was modest but useful—11 games, six points, four rebounds, and three steals—showing a player who impacts the game in small, gritty ways rather than chasing headlines.[10] She fits best as a team-first guard who can defend, make simple plays, and keep possessions clean; the upside is reliability, not flash.[10][12]
